Abstract

Background Electrical cardioversion (EC) is a procedure that restores normal sinus rhythm in patients with atrial fibrillation (AF). Data on post-EC outcomes relative to the success of inpatient EC is limited. Methods This is a retrospective study of patients admitted for AF who underwent inpatient EC from January 1, 2017, to January 1, 2021. We collected demographics and clinical, biochemical, and echocardiographic parameters that impact the success of EC. Outcome events were 30-day readmissions and mortality. Results Our study included 54 unique patients who either had EC in the emergency room or as part of their hospital admission course for atrial fibrillation. Most patients were men with an average age of 70 years with traditional risk factors for cardiovascular disease including heart failure, coronary artery disease, and chronic kidney disease. The group who had unsuccessful cardioversion was older than those in the ineffective EC. Mortality at 30 days (p < 0.01), 1 year (p < 0.01), and 30-day readmission rate (p < 0.01) were higher in patients with unsuccessful EC. Conclusion A predictive model for successful EC remains difficult to establish. Patients with unsuccessful in-hospital EC are at high risk for mortality and readmissionat 30 days and require a comprehensive pre-discharge multidisciplinary approach and prioritized and individualized post-discharge integrated care.
